Alternative Name(s): GroEL protein; Protein Cpn60

Relevance: Prevents misfolding and promotes the refolding and proper assembly of unfolded polypeptides generated under stress conditions

Storage: The shelf life is related to many factors, storage state, buffer ingredients, storage temperature and the stability of the protein itself. Generally, the shelf life of liquid form is 6 months at -20℃/-80℃. The shelf life of lyophilized form is 12 months at -20℃/-80℃.

Notes: Repeated freezing and thawing is not recommended. Store working aliquots at 4℃ for up to one week.
